Medical Detoxification
Medical detoxification is the first step in opioid rehab at Bridgewater centers. It aims to manage acute physical symptoms that occur when stopping or reducing substance use significantly. Medical professionals provide round-the-clock care during this stage to monitor patients’ conditions continuously, alleviate withdrawal symptoms with medication if necessary, and ensure safety.

Counseling and Behavioral Therapies
These therapies form an integral part of treating opioid addiction in Bridgewater rehabs by addressing psychosocial aspects of drug abuse – such as triggers for usage – hence enhancing effective coping mechanisms.
Individual counseling focuses on reducing or stopping substance use through techniques like motivational interviewing and c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T). Group therapies offer social reinforcement from peers undergoing similar struggles.

Comparing Inpatient and Outpatient Opioid Rehab
Deciding between inpatient and outpatient opioid rehab involves weighing the pros and cons of each approach. Let’s delve into both options, focusing on how they operate in Bridgewater.
The Pros and Cons of Inpatient Treatment
Inpatient treatment offers intensive care for individuals battling addiction. Patients reside at a facility like ‘Bridgewater Healing Center’ or ‘Recovery Solutions’ that provide round-the-clock medical supervision during the initial detox phase followed by structured therapy sessions.
Pros:
- 24/7 Medical Supervision: Dealing with withdrawal symptoms can be daunting, but 24-hour support assures immediate attention to any adverse effects.
- Focus on Recovery: By staying within a dedicated center, patients avoid everyday stressors aiding faster recovery.
- Structured Programs: Centers offer holistic programs including group therapies, individual counseling aiding in overall personal growth towards living dependency-free.
Cons:
- Limited Outside Interaction: Staying at an isolated location can limit interaction with family members which might impact some patients negatively.
- Costlier Than Outpatients Services: Due to constant medical care & accommodations provided, these services are generally more expensive than their counterparts.
The Pros and Cons of Outpatient Treatment
Outpatient treatment allows individuals to live at home while attending scheduled therapy sessions at local clinics or centers like ‘Addiction101’.
Pros:
- Flexibility: Perfect for people who cannot commit full-time due to work or family obligations yet wish to seek treatment concurrently.
- Maintain Regular Life Routines: Individuals continue their regular lives which often includes school attendance or job commitments alongside therapy appointments
3.,Cost-Effective Option: It is usually less costly compared to residential/in-patient treatments owing majorly because there aren’t accommodation expenses involved.
Cons:
1.,Risk Of Exposure to Triggers: Being in their natural environment may expose patients to triggers leading them back into old habits.
2.,Requires High Level Of Self-Discipline: The success of outpatient treatment relies heavily on an individual’s dedication and commitment towards sobriety.
